3.
Launch UUI, and select CentOS as the desired Linux Distribution
4.
Point UUI to the .iso downloaded in step 1.
5.
Select desired USB drive to install to, and then click "Create". Wait for the process to
complete, then USB is ready to use.
6. Plug in USB to affected server and select it as the desired boot device.
Note: The USB loaded with the above image will boot to CentOS, and then launch a series of
UCScfg commands. This particular .iso corrects the optionROM settings AND sets the MLOM Port
0 as the first boot device. After the configuration changes complete, the server will power off.
Changes will be reflected at next power on. UCScfg can be used to customize BIOS/IMC settings
as desired, and the process shown above is just an example, and will correct the issues
mentioned in this article only.
